Output 877954da843a473d691be0224a6417bcdda87faf29a803b5add7d115153e0de7:1

value
3603499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b32357e3909acf10564c09561bd01bd1de3bb3 OP_EQUAL
address
39gjJxqpBBFnZXNXrQE9fyqfChUzCaUfKc
transaction
877954da843a473d691be0224a6417bcdda87faf29a803b5add7d115153e0de7
spent
true